PROJECT INTRODUCTION: You will be creating a comprehensive presentation on your ideas for a dream vacation.

PART 2 : DREAM VACATION PROJECT

Instructions: Create a 10 slide PowerPoint about a Dream Vacation; it can be on more than one place you want to visit.

Starter: Open a blank PowerPoint, click File, New, Search Online for a different theme that you have not used before. Use Slide Master to change colors, fonts, effects, and placeholders to customize your presentation.
In Slide Master, create THREE custom layouts. Rename them your name-layout 1, 2, 3.
Add a different shape on each layout with the number 1, 2, 3 in it.
Add different placeholders to each of the three custom layouts.
Make sure to use all three custom layouts somewhere in your presentation and label them in the title of the slide.

Requirements:

  • Original Theme that you have customized in SlideMaster (DO NOT USE ONE OF THE DEFAULT THEMES!)

  • At least 10 images (you can do more). All images have Picture Style, Boarders, and Special Effects

  • Action Buttons that lead to Next Slide, Previous Slides, and Home

  • At least 2 slides with shapes that have been grouped together

  • At least 1 Animation per slide

  • 1 Transition per slide. Transitions move automatically

  • Music across multiple slides

  • 2 videos. Video have a Poster Frame, Video Style, Video Shape, Video Effects, and start automatically

  • 1 Hyperlink to a Website, and 1 Hyperlink to another slide that is not a previous, next, or home action button. Find creative ways to add your Hyperlinks

Peer Review – Slide #11:

When you have completed your work, but before you turn in your project, have a neighbor add an 11th slide to their PowerPoint – “<Your Name> Peer Review”. Give your honest feedback about their PowerPoint. Give them 2 things you like about their PowerPoint, and 1 thing they could change.
